The Saucony Endorphin Azura is designed for adult male runners seeking a fast and light daily trainer. Its key benefit is providing a smooth, bouncy, and responsive ride for everyday miles without a carbon plate, making it accessible for varied paces. A potential caveat is its focus on speed, which might feel less cushioned for ultra-long, slow runs compared to max-cushion shoes. This trainer features PWRRUN PB foam for soft cushioning and SpeedRoll technology for efficient transitions, combined with durable XT-900 rubber and an adaptive fit for a secure feel.

No, the Saucony Endorphin Azura does not feature a carbon plate. It provides its energetic and responsive feel through the combination of PWRRUN PB foam and SpeedRoll technology.
SpeedRoll technology is designed to create a forward-rocking sensation, which helps to make your stride feel smoother and more efficient, promoting quicker transitions from foot strike to toe-off.
PWRRUN PB foam is a soft and bouncy cushioning material that provides excellent energy return. It absorbs impact effectively while giving a lively feel to each step, reducing fatigue over the miles.
The Saucony Endorphin Azura has a heel-to-toe drop of 8mm.
